Molly and I tried this Garlic Hummus recipe recently and it was so quick and easy to make but was DELICIOUS. I hope you enjoy!


HERE’S WHAT YOU NEED:

  • 1 can of drained and rinsed chick peas (garbanzo beans)
  • 3 cloves of garlic
  • 7 tbsp Tahini
  • 1 fresh squeeze of lemon
  • 1/4 cup of extra virgin ol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Combine ingredients into a large mixing bowl.

Blend on high for 3-4 minutes until smooth.

Serve with veggies, pita chips or anything you like. We used fresh veggies from the garden.
